Directors' concerns: distributions and dividends
Ever since the legal concept of the company was created, there has been discussion about what the purpose is of companies and why they should exist. Directors are under a duty to exercise their powers in the best interests of the company but one of the issues that directors need to consider when running the company is the interests of the shareholders — the owners of the company.
